Who is Batista? What country does Batista belong to?
Dave Bautista, better known as Batista, is an American actor, bodybuilder, and former professional wrestler. He is best known for his time in the WWE, where he was a six-time world champion.
Batista was born in Washington, D.C., to a Filipino mother and a Greek father. He is of Filipino and Greek descent. Batista has stated that he is "proud to be both Filipino and Greek" and that he "identifies with both cultures."
